Output f8e32c5f33723098505be02a65fe8a8a6f0687cf1746cb8ef2e4acca1193f4aa:0

value
85000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7fc63bf8ad4f460babe18d6fc452d1201d6f13f OP_EQUAL
address
3MP3Z8KXnxvZQMzM4rwD6GLTZeq4ZD811u
transaction
f8e32c5f33723098505be02a65fe8a8a6f0687cf1746cb8ef2e4acca1193f4aa
confirmations
3452
spent
true